Visa stock price slides after earnings beat as costs and cross-border spending take center stage

Visa shares fell 2.4% to $323.99 in late morning trading Friday after reporting a 15% jump in quarterly net revenue to $10.9 billion. Investors focused on rising operating expenses and cross-border activity, with the company adding $500 million to a litigation escrow. Visa’s board approved a $0.67 quarterly dividend, payable March 2 to shareholders of record Feb. 10.

Mastercard stock is down today — what Wall Street is watching after earnings

Mastercard shares fell 1.2% to $537.26 Friday as payment stocks declined, with Visa down 2.6% and American Express off 3.7%. Mastercard will cut about 4% of staff, incurring a $200 million restructuring charge in Q1. Switched volume rose 9% year over year, but travel-related cross-border growth slowed. Mastercard repurchased $3.6 billion in shares in Q4 and paid $684 million in dividends.

ServiceNow (NOW) stock steadies after post-earnings jolt — buyback plan and 2026 outlook in focus

ServiceNow shares rose 0.3% to $117.12 in late-morning trading Friday, recovering slightly after a 10% drop Thursday. The company reported fourth-quarter subscription revenue up 21% to $3.466 billion and projected 2026 subscription revenue above analyst estimates. The board approved an additional $5 billion for share buybacks. ServiceNow also expanded its partnership with Fiserv for financial-services operations.

Exxon Mobil stock price slips after earnings beat as chemicals turn red; what XOM investors watch next

Exxon Mobil shares fell 0.7% to $139.52 Friday after the company posted $6.5 billion in fourth-quarter earnings and a rare loss in its chemicals division. Production hit a four-decade high at 4.7 million barrels per day for the year. Brent crude traded near $72 ahead of Sunday’s OPEC+ meeting. Exxon confirmed a $20 billion buyback plan through 2026 and raised its quarterly dividend to $1.03 per share.

Seagate stock slides after earnings pop as traders weigh AI-storage boom

Seagate shares fell 4.2% to $427.68 in early Friday trading, reversing part of a 19% surge earlier this week after strong earnings and an upbeat forecast. The company reported $2.83 billion in quarterly revenue and projected up to $3.40 per share in adjusted earnings. Investors are watching storage pricing and cloud demand. Seagate’s board declared a $0.74 dividend, payable April 8.

Apple stock price rises after earnings beat and upbeat forecast — AAPL investors watch chip crunch

Apple shares rose 0.6% to $258.28 in early Friday trading after the company forecast March-quarter revenue growth of 13% to 16%, topping analyst estimates. Apple reported $143.76 billion in quarterly revenue and $42.10 billion net income, with iPhone sales at $85.27 billion. CEO Tim Cook cited record device numbers but warned of chip and memory shortages. Apple confirmed acquiring Israeli AI startup Q.ai for about $1.6 billion.
